Real Estate Market Update | Metro Phoenix | 2022 vs 2021

Real Estate Market Update | Metro Phoenix | 2022 vs 2021

According to Flex-MLS, the Marketplace for MetroPhoenix Residential Properties, in Quarter 4, 2022 versus Quarter 4, 2021:

The Number of SOLD listings decreased by 28% to 6,545 units, with a top sale of $21,000,000 at 6015 E Cameldale Way, in Paradise Valley.

The Average Sales Price increased by 14% to $939,524, moving the Average Price Per Sq Foot up to $382 per sq foot.

The inventory of properties available for sale, measured in month’s supply, increased by 25% to 1.48 months worth of properties for sale.

Mortgage rates increased with the 30 year fixed rate average up 106% to 6.74%, according to Bank Rate.com

In spite of media headlines, MetroPhoenix experienced overall market appreciation of 14% year over year. Currently MetroPhoenix is teetering between a ‘mild’ sellers market and a ‘balanced’ market. However, after a long 4th quarter sellers should be able to enjoy fewer days on market, and serious buyers in the first half of 2023. The best advice for buyers is to stay engaged with where rates are on a daily basis, and be fully educated on lender programs and seller incentives available so that they can be the first to act when the property and the payment is right for them.

Metro Phoenix

Average Sales Price: 2021 > $821,495 vs 2022 > $939,524 = 14% increase
Average Days On Market: 2021 > 37 vs 2022 > 40 = 8% increase
Average Sale Price Per Square Foot: 2021 > $303 vs 2022 > $382 = 26% increase
Sale to List Price Ratio: 2021 > 99.53% vs 2022 > 98.63% = 1% decrease
Number of Sold Listings: 2021 > 9102 vs 2022 > 6545 = 28% decrease
Months Supply of Inventory: 2021 > 1.19 vs 2022 > 1.48 = 25% increase
Mortgage Rate: 2021 > 3.27% vs 2022 > 6.74% = 106% increase
